Energy efficiency measures  for this building includes use of insulation in external walls & roof, optimized window-to-wall ratio, efficient glazing, high efficiency water cooled chiller, & LED lighting and rooftop solar photovoltaic system. All these factors brings the Benchmark Comparison value near the Architecture 2030 by not increasing the cost of the building material.

The most important factors settings to reach building performance goals

  • Lighting Efficiency - 0.7W/sf-0.3W/sf

One of the major pros of using energy efficient lighting is the fact it uses far less energy than traditional lights.  Using LED lightings on all the places instead of traditional lighting could save 25%-30% energy which could reduce significantly electricity charges.

  • Plug Load Efficiency -  1.3W/sf-0.6W/sf

Plug load control strategies by tracking the plug load and controlling the plug load are two major factors to achieve plug load efficiency. Purpose to choose this option is to reduce the wasted energy, improve control and save money. Smart plug  could help to manage the plug load based on work schedule, weather conditions etc.

  • PV - Payback Limit-   30 yr

Photovoltaic (PV) companies give valuable warranties for PV panels in terms of both PV panel life span (years of PV life) and PV panels’ efficiency levels across time. PV panels can last up to 30 years or more so we have selected PV-payback limit as to 30 yr.

  • Daylighting & Occupancy Control

By daylighting  & occupancy controls lights can be automatically dimmed/turned off according to occupancy or available daylight.  Electrical equipment life will be increased by less use and provided configurable light levels relative to tasks. Its provide programmable, preferences to setup the schedule based on lighting requirements.  It provides security by configuring outdoor lights to automatically turn on between dusk and dawn,  and provide ability to configure security alarms.
